The Between is a time-bending paranormal mystery that fits squarely in the category of "fever dream." Alongside Hilton, Due has her readers questioning what is real and what is a dream. Or are our dreams really just portals into alternate timelines? The eventual suggestion that you could be stalked by a murderer via your dreams is truly chilling. Additionally, the way that Due fuses Hilton and his wife's trauma-informed anxieties about racially motivated hatred with the paranormal terrors makes this already nerve-wracking book even more so.

As a whole, I really enjoyed descending into sleepless mania with Hilton as he attempted to solve the mystery of his unusual life. My only qualm with The Between was that I wanted to know more about Hilton's grandmother and how she discovered her dream abilities.
